Who are the 'useful idiots' in comic novels?
In some comic novels, 'useful idiots' could be those naive characters who are easily manipulated by the main villain or antagonist. For example, a character who blindly follows the orders of a devious plotter without realizing they are being used.

Why is Comic Sans considered for idiots?
Comic Sans is thought to be for idiots because it's often overused and doesn't convey a sense of professionalism. Also, its style can be hard to read in some cases.
